Moving to the Phoenix area of Arizona from Farmington Hills, Michigan is a great decision for several reasons. The benefits of living in this vibrant and rapidly growing city are numerous, and the recent announcement of the new TSMC plant only adds to the appeal.

First and foremost, the weather in Phoenix is a major draw for many people. The city boasts over 300 days of sunshine per year, making it an ideal location for those who enjoy outdoor activities. The warm, dry climate also means that residents can enjoy a variety of outdoor activities year-round, such as hiking, biking, and golfing. This is a stark contrast to the cold and snowy winters of Farmington Hills, making Phoenix an attractive option for those looking to escape the harsh Midwest weather.

In addition to the weather, the cost of living in Phoenix is significantly lower than in Farmington Hills. According to recent data, the cost of living in Phoenix is 12% lower than the national average, while Farmington Hills is 24% higher. This means that residents can enjoy a higher standard of living in Phoenix for a lower cost, which is especially appealing for families and young professionals.

Furthermore, Phoenix offers a diverse and thriving job market. The city is home to many major corporations, including Intel, American Express, and now the new TSMC plant. This will bring thousands of high-paying jobs to the area, providing even more opportunities for residents. The TSMC plant, which is expected to be operational by 2024, will be the company's first manufacturing site in the United States and is projected to create over 1,600 jobs. This will not only boost the local economy but also attract more businesses and professionals to the area.

Another benefit of living in Phoenix is the abundance of cultural and recreational activities. The city is home to numerous museums, art galleries, and theaters, as well as professional sports teams like the Phoenix Suns and Arizona Diamondbacks. Phoenix also has a vibrant food scene, with a variety of restaurants offering diverse cuisines. And for those who enjoy weekend getaways, Phoenix is conveniently located near popular destinations like Sedona, Flagstaff, and the Grand Canyon.
